Hosts Jim Connelly, Derek Schooley, and Ed Trefzger look at this past weekend’s games and news. Topics include:
• With No. 1 Michigan losing twice in OT and No. 2 St. Cloud State getting swept, it was a difficult poll ballot;
• Western Michigan did what it needed to do, and emphatically so;
• Getting a feel for the ECAC;
• Minnesota Duluth and North Dakota gave us exactly what we expected
• Boston College postponed a trip to Notre Dame and a home game vs. Harvard for COVID-19 precautions;
• What we’re thankful for in college hockey this Thanksgiving.
